On this episode of Levels to This, Sheryl Swoopes and Terrika Foster-Brasby break down the two moves that shook up the WNBA trade deadline: Aneesah Morrow heading from the Connecticut Sun to the Toronto Tempo, and All-Star guard Kelsey Plum getting dealt from the Sparks to the Phoenix Mercury. Sheryl admits she was already picturing Morrow in a Houston uniform, while Terrika digs into why a double-double machine kept riding the bench in Connecticut. They also try to make sense of the Plum move: why L.A. would break up a team it just built, whether Plum wanted out, and what both trades signal about which franchises are suddenly in win-now mode. Plus, the duo comes to the defense of analyst Monica McNutt, who caught heat for doing a TV hit from a pedicure chair ON HER DAY OFF— and they're not having the "unserious" talk.
